Catalog description
Offered: F. This course includes a study of the theories of first and second language acquisition. Subtopics of this area of study include: bilingualism, cognitive styles, communicative styles, personality factors, socio-cultural differences, learning theory, models of language acquisition, strategies used by adults and children in acquiring second or third language and the application of these factors to language teaching.
